DATAJDBC-490 - Support condition grouping.

We now support condition groups (WHERE (a = b OR b = c) AND (e = f)) with the SQL AST via Condition.group().

package org.springframework.data.relational.core.sql;
/**
* Condition group wrapping a nested {@link Condition} with parentheses.
*
* @author Mark Paluch
* @since 2.0
*/
public class ConditionGroup extends MultipleCondition implements Condition {
ConditionGroup(Condition condition) {
super("", condition);
}
/*
* (non-Javadoc)
* @see java.lang.Object#toString()
*/
@Override
public String toString() {
return "(" + super.toString() + ")";
}
}

@Test // DATAJDBC-490
public void shouldRenderEqualsGroup() {
String sql = SqlRenderer
.toString(StatementBuilder.select(left).from(table).where(left.isEqualTo(right).group()).build());
assertThat(sql).endsWith("WHERE (my_table.left = my_table.right)");
}
@Test // DATAJDBC-490
public void shouldRenderAndGroup() {
String sql = SqlRenderer.toString(StatementBuilder.select(left).from(table)
.where(left.isEqualTo(right).and(left.isGreater(right)).group()).build());
assertThat(sql).endsWith("WHERE (my_table.left = my_table.right AND my_table.left > my_table.right)");
}
@Test // DATAJDBC-490
public void shouldRenderAndGroupOr() {
String sql = SqlRenderer.toString(StatementBuilder.select(left).from(table)
.where(left.isEqualTo(right).and(left.isGreater(right)).group().or(left.like(right))).build());
assertThat(sql).endsWith(
"WHERE (my_table.left = my_table.right AND my_table.left > my_table.right) OR my_table.left LIKE my_table.right");
}
